The hamstrings are often thought of and referred to as one muscle, but the hamstrings are a group of three muscles on your posterior thigh: biceps femoris (long and short head), semitendinosus, and semimembranosus. These three hamstring muscles originate in the posterior lower pelvis, and they insert medially and laterally below the knee on the fibula and tibia.

Think of your legs like a car. Your quads act like shock absorbers for the knee and the hamstrings act like the brakes. If your brakes don’t work, your knees are in trouble. So, training the hamstrings will go a long way in keeping your knees healthy. Here are a few other important benefits of training your hamstrings.

To add muscle and strength to the hamstrings you need exercises that go through a large range of motion. This gives you more muscle-building potential because the hamstrings are under tension longer.
